II. Historical Evolution of Advertising
A. Early Forms of Advertising
Advertising, in numerous types, has been an important part of human history considering that ancient times. Early civilizations used basic approaches to promote items and services, leveraging fundamental interaction strategies to reach potential clients. Some early forms of advertising consist of:
-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ders utilized pictorial indications and symbols to recognize their shops and show the items they offered. These visual cues worked as an early form of branding and assisted illiterate people recognize companies.
- Town Criers: In medieval Europe, town criers played an important function in distributing information and advertising events. They would openly reveal news, proclamations, and commercial messages, serving as human "speakers" for services and authorities.
-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These marketing products were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to notify the regional neighborhood about items, services, and events.
B. The Birth of Modern Advertising
The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century brought about significant changes to the advertising landscape. Advancements in innovation and mass production, coupled with the growth of urban centers, created brand-new chances for organizations to reach larger audiences. Secret turning points in the birth of contemporary advertising include:
- Newspapers and Magazines: With the increase of industrialization and the printing press, newspapers and publications became prominent advertising platforms. Organizations started placing paid ads in publications, targeting particular demographics based upon readership.
-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, companies recognized the requirement for distinction. They started embracing logos and mottos to establish brand name identities that customers could acknowledge and trust.
-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first ad agency were developed, marking a shift from individual services handling their promos to customized companies using advertising services. These firms brought a more strategic and imaginative method to advertising.

Online Banner Ads
Online banner advertisements are one of the earliest and most identifiable types of digital advertising. These visual advertisements are displayed on sites, usually at the top, bottom, or sides of a page. Banner ads can be fixed images, animated gifs, or perhaps interactive multimedia components. They intend to get the attention of website visitors and direct them to the advertiser's website or landing page. The success of banner ads depends on compelling visuals, memorable copy, and tactical advertisement positioning on pertinent sites.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)
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a form of paid advertising that intends to increase a site's exposure on search engine results pages (SERPs). It includes bidding on particular keywords pertinent to business, and when users search for those keywords, the ads appear at the top or bottom of the search results. SEM can be highly reliable as it targets users actively searching for service or products associated with the advertiser's offerings. Google Ads (previously known as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, but other search engines like Bing also use similar advertising chances.
Email Marketing
Email marketing stays a potent tool for services to connect with their existing and possible customers. It includes sending targeted emails to a thoroughly curated list of subscribers. These emails can serve various functions, such as promoting new products, offering unique deals, sharing important material, or nurturing leads through automated drip campaigns. Email marketing can be extremely individualized, permitting organizations to tailor messages based upon user preferences and habits. To be successful, email marketing requires engaging content, properly designed design templates, and compliance with anti-spam regulations.
